In the midst of deadlines, car pools, and breakfast dishes, it can be tempting to push aside your longing for intimate friendships. Why add something else to your schedule-and be hurt or disappointed again? Yet it seems that even in the busyness and struggles of life, we cannot ignore our ache to know kindred spirits.\ In The Friendships of Women, Dee Brestin encourages you to listen to your need for friendships and to find and strengthen those relationships.
